Week 8 Reflection

This course has helped me to develop my own technology skills as a professional teacher because it forced me to go out and do my own research on blogging and wikis. We learned everything hands on which makes things so much more concrete. I am now not so much afraid to try new things or use new things in the classroom because I know that I can teach myself anything that is needed. It has also shown me that using technology is a great way of bringing something that my students love into the classroom. I plan on using blogging in my classes next year to add a new element into my teaching.

I have deepened my knowledge of the teaching and learning process because I have realized that it is okay to do something on your own. It is almost more concrete to me to use the hands-on learning that we did in this class than if someone had given us step-by-step directions to complete every task. Because of this, I really plan on trying to become more learner-centered in my class. It is a great thing when you look back and see everything that you have accomplished rather than if someone put it right in front of you the entire time.

I plan on trying every piece of technology that I can in order to expand my knowledge of learning, teaching, and leading with technology. I plan on showing my coworkers how to use it as well in order to make them more comfortable. I also would like to begin working on more projects which incorporate technology in them in order to increase student achievement as well as participation.

Two longterm goals to transform my classroom are going to be to start using blogging in my classroom and to do more projects that are technology based with my students. Some obstacles that I will have to overcome would be if students do not have the means to use the technology at home or time during the day to use it at school. Something else that would hinder progress would be if students weren't comfortable with the technology. I plan on overcoming these obstacles and accomplishing my goals by setting aside time to go to the computer lab with my students when these projects and blogs arise in order to trouble shoot whatever kinds of problems that they may face.
